Northrop Grumman on Track for Longest Losing Streak Since October 2018 -- Data Talk

Dow Jones04-24 23:35

Northrop Grumman Corp. $(NOC)$ is currently at $572.70, down $14.96 or 2.55%

 

--Would be lowest close since Dec. 31, 2025, when it closed at $570.21

--On pace for largest percent decrease since April 22, 2026, when it fell 3.52%

--Currently down 10 of the past 11 days

--Currently down nine consecutive days; down 15.94% over this period

--Longest losing streak since Oct. 29, 2018, when it fell for nine straight trading days

--Worst nine-day stretch since the nine days ending Jan. 19, 2023, when it fell 16.31%

--Down 13.91% this week; worst weekly performance since the week ending Feb. 27, 2009, when it fell 15.91%

--Down 16.06% month-to-date; on pace for worst month since Jan. 2023, when it fell 17.88%

--Up 0.44% year-to-date

--Down 25.43% from its all-time closing high of $768.02 on March 2, 2026

--Up 21.03% from 52 weeks ago (April 25, 2025), when it closed at $473.20

--Down 25.43% from its 52-week closing high of $768.02 on March 2, 2026

--Up 25.51% from its 52-week closing low of $456.30 on May 14, 2025

--Traded as low as $569.86; lowest intraday level since Jan. 2, 2026, when it hit $564.50

--Down 3.03% at today's intraday low

 

All data as of 11:32:58 AM ET

 

Source: Dow Jones Market Data, FactSet
